Serif Normal Ukbup 5 is a very light, narrow, high cont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A delicate serif with hairline-thin strokes and strong thick–thin modulation, giving the letters a polished, high-contrast rhythm. Serifs are fine and sharp with a clean, modern crispness, while curves are smooth and tightly controlled. Proportions are generally compact with tall capitals and a restrained, even x-height; counters are open but not generous, emphasizing a poised vertical presence. Numerals follow the same refined contrast, with light joins and elegant curves that match the text color in running lines.
Best suited to magazines, lookbooks, and other editorial settings where a refined, high-contrast serif is expected. It will also work well for display typography such as headlines, pull quotes, packaging, and formal collateral like invitations or certificates, where its delicate detailing can be preserved.
The overall tone is sophisticated and editorial, with a fashion-forward elegance that reads as formal and carefully composed. Its lightness and precision suggest luxury, restraint, and a classic sensibility rather than warmth or informality.
The design appears intended to deliver a premium, classic serif voice with contemporary cleanliness—prioritizing elegance, contrast, and visual refinement for high-end display and editorial use.
In text, the thin horizontals and hairline details create a bright, sparkling texture and a slightly fragile feel, especially at smaller sizes or in dense passages. The design favors crisp outlines and graceful terminals over robustness, making it particularly sensitive to reproduction conditions.
